Comparison of phenolic acids and flavonoids in leaves and berries of different varieties of seabuckthorn
[Objective]Provide reference for the development and utilization of seabuckthorn phenolic acid and flavonoid resources,as well as targeted breeding.[Method]Eleven sea buckthorn varieties were selected as the research objects,and liquid chromatography-mass spectrometry(HPLC-MS/MS)was used to detect the phenolic acid and flavonoid components in the leaves and berries of each variety,and differences were compared and analyzed.[Result]Ten phenolic acid components,including ferulic acid,vanillic acid,and p-coumaric acid,were detected in the leaves of 11 seabuckthorn varieties,with a total content of 1 032.466-3 354.984 μg/g.Among them,'Zhonghongguo'(3 354.984 μg/g)and'201309'(2066.444 μg/g)had the highest total phenolic acid content,mainly composed of ferulic acid,vanillic acid,p-coumaric acid,and gallic acid.Eight flavonoids,including rutin,epigallocatechin gallate,and quercetin,were detected in the leaves of 11 sea buckthorn varieties,with a total content of 181.359-617.098 μg/g.Rutin was the main component,and the varieties with the highest total flavonoid content were also'Zhonghongguo'(617.098 μg/g)and'201309'(451.432 μg/g).Five phenolic acids,namely protocatechuic acid,syringic acid,p-coumaric acid,gallic acid,and caffeic acid,were detected in the berries of 11 varieties,with a total content of 25.002-98.009 μg/g.The phenolic acid content of'Zaciyou 10'(98.009 μg/g)and'201308'(77.503 μg/g)was relatively high,with p-coumaric acid being the main component.Eight types of flavonoids could be detected in the berries of 11 varieties,with a total content of 54.219-351.622 μg/g.The content of'201301'(351.622 μg/g)and'201308'(189.981 μg/g)was relatively high,and the main flavonoid component was also rutin.[Conclusion]'Zhonghongguo'and'201309'can be used as phenolic acid and flavonoid resources in seabuckthorn leaves,while'Zaciyou10','201308'and'201301'can be used as phenolic acid and flavonoid resources in seabuckthorn berries for targeted cultivation and demonstration promotion.
